Kanawha Trail Club will sponsor a hike Sunday on Nuttallburg trails near the New River Gorge. Meet at noon to carpool from Ohio and Randolph streets. Regroup at Canyon Rim Visitors Center. The hike is 3 miles long on easy trails. Enjoy views of the gorge and historical interpretations. There is an optional additional 1 mile hike that is a moderate uphill climb.

Joker Run-Walk

Charleston Parks and Recreation and Tallman Track Club will sponsor a Joker Run-Walk and Joker for Kids March 24 at West Virginia University/CAMC Memorial Hospital in Kanawha City. The event starts on 31st Street and Virginia Avenue. The walk begins at 1 p.m., the Joker for Kids at 1:05 p.m. and the run begins at 2 p.m. The Joker Run will consist of a 4-mile/8-mile run, 5K walk; and the Joker for Kids, ages 4-7, race 1/2 mile, and 8-12 years' 1-mile race. The registration fee is $25. There is no fee for the Joker for Kids. Registration opens at noon on race day. Prizes will be awarded, and participants will receive a Joker Run T-shirt. Contract bridge class

Putnam County Parks and Recreation Commission is hosting beginners contract bridge card classes from 7 to 9:30 p.m. March 26 through June 11 in the Commons at Valley Park in Hurricane. Dollhouse club

Mountaineer Miniatures of Fairmont, the only dollhouse club in the state, is sponsoring its annual show and sale from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. April 13 at the Ramada Inn near Morgantown. A furnished three-story dollhouse will be raffled off at $1 a ticket or six for $5. All proceeds from the raffle and the $1 admission for adults will be given to Make-A-Wish Foundation. There will be vendor tables. The Ramada Inn is located off Interstate 79 exit 148/Interstate 68 exit 1.
